Are there residential inpatient rehab centers located directly in Kitty Hawk, NC, or will I need to travel to nearby cities?
Kitty Hawk itself is a small coastal town with limited medical infrastructure, so there are no residential inpatient rehab facilities within the town limits. However, residents typically access treatment at centers in larger nearby cities like Nags Head, Manteo, or Elizabeth City, or travel further to facilities in the Outer Banks region or the Tidewater area of Virginia, which are within a reasonable driving distance.
How can I find outpatient addiction treatment programs that accept Medicaid in the Kitty Hawk area?
For Medicaid-accepted outpatient services near Kitty Hawk, you should contact the Outer Banks area offices of Trillium Health Resources, the local managed care organization for behavioral health. They can provide referrals to approved providers like PORT Health or other local clinics in Dare and Currituck counties. Additionally, the Dare County Department of Health & Human Services in Manteo can assist with eligibility and local program options.
What local support groups, like AA or NA, are available for ongoing recovery in Kitty Hawk?
Kitty Hawk and the surrounding Outer Banks communities host several 12-step meetings. Regular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A) meetings are held at local churches and community centers in Kitty Hawk, Kill Devil Hills, and Nags Head. You can find the most current schedules by contacting the Outer Banks Intergroup for AA or searching the NA Eastern North Carolina region website for meetings in Dare County.

What is the process for a resident of Kitty Hawk to get a timely assessment or intervention for a substance use disorder?
For an urgent assessment in Kitty Hawk, start by calling the 24/7 Trillium Health Resources Access to Care line at 1-877-685-2415. They can conduct a crisis screening and refer you to the nearest available provider, such as the PORT Health center in Nags Head or the emergency/crisis services at the Outer Banks Hospital. For non-urgent cases, contacting the Dare County Behavioral Health agency directly can help schedule a local evaluation.
